| # ----- Function to perform DuckDuckGo search and retrieve concise context ----- | |
| def retrieve_context(query, max_results=2, max_chars_per_result=150): | |
| """ | |
| Query DuckDuckGo for the given search query and return a concatenated context string. | |
| Uses the DDGS().text() generator (with region, safesearch, and timelimit parameters) | |
| and limits the results using islice. Each result's title and snippet are combined into context. | |
| """ | |
| try: | |
| with DDGS() as ddgs: | |
| results_gen = ddgs.text(query, region="wt-wt", safesearch="off", timelimit="y") | |
| results = list(islice(results_gen, max_results)) | |
| context = "" | |
| if results: | |
| for i, result in enumerate(results, start=1): | |
| title = result.get("title", "No Title") | |
| snippet = result.get("body", "")[:max_chars_per_result] | |
| context += f"Result {i}:\nTitle: {title}\nSnippet: {snippet}\n\n" | |
| return context.strip() | |
| except Exception as e: | |
| st.error(f"Error during retrieval: {e}") | |
| return "" | |

| # ----- Helper functions for model management ----- | |
| def try_load_model(path): | |
| try: | |
| return Llama( | |
| model_path=path, | |
| n_ctx=512, # Reduced context window to save memory | |
| n_threads=1, # Fewer threads for resource-constrained environments | |
| n_threads_batch=1, | |
| n_batch=2, # Lower batch size to conserve memory | |
| n_gpu_layers=0, | |
| use_mlock=False, | |
| use_mmap=True, | |
| verbose=False, | |
| ) | |
| except Exception as e: | |
| return str(e) | |
| def download_model(): | |
| with st.spinner(f"Downloading {selected_model['filename']}..."): | |
| hf_hub_download( | |
| repo_id=selected_model["repo_id"], | |
| filename=selected_model["filename"], | |
| local_dir="./models", | |
| local_dir_use_symlinks=False, | |
| ) | |
| def validate_or_download_model(): | |
| if not os.path.exists(model_path): | |
| free_space = shutil.disk_usage(".").free | |
| if free_space < REQUIRED_SPACE_BYTES: | |
| st.info("Insufficient storage. Consider cleaning up old models.") | |
| download_model() | |
| result = try_load_model(model_path) | |
| if isinstance(result, str): | |
| st.warning(f"Initial load failed: {result}\nAttempting re-download...") | |
| try: | |
| os.remove(model_path) | |
| except Exception: | |
| pass | |
| download_model() | |
| result = try_load_model(model_path) | |
| if isinstance(result, str): | |
| st.error(f"Model still failed after re-download: {result}") | |
| st.stop() | |
| return result | |
| return result | |
